A Milwaukee landlord found a peculiar print hanging in a vacant apartment; it turned out to be an original Picasso that had been missing for eight years
- When an original Picasso disappeared from a Milwaukee gallery in 2018, owners wondered if they would ever see it again.
- But in August 2026, a man turned the art over to the police.
- Timothy Dertz noticed an intriguing artwork on the wall of his apartment after his tenant moved out.
